Before you contrast business, take an honest look at your house itself. Solar works finest when the physical conditions make sense. That does not indicate a home requires a big, perfectly south-facing roof covering. Plenty of good systems go on east-west roofings or on homes with modest shading. It does imply that the appropriate installer should evaluate the roof covering meticulously rather than treating every home like a basic template.
Roof age is among the very first filters. If the roof has just a few years of life left, mounting panels currently can be a false economic climate. Getting rid of and reinstalling a system later on includes price, documents, and hassle. A credible contractor will certainly inform you when reroofing very first is the wiser move, also if it postpones the project.
Shade should have the very same degree of scrutiny. Trees on a surrounding residential property, a chimney, dormers, satellite dishes, and seasonal sunlight angles can all minimize output. Some salesmen talk around this point due to the fact that shading makes complex the sale. Much better installers design it, describe it, and readjust the design appropriately. Sometimes the response is module-level power electronics. Sometimes the solution is cutting a tree. Occasionally the response is that part of the roof should be left alone.
Electrical solution is one more practical checkpoint. Older homes may require panel upgrades or subpanel adjustments before solar can be connected cleanly. This is not an offer breaker, however it transforms expense and extent. A professional solar installation Fairfield business ought to recognize that early, not midway through permitting.

Two systems with the exact same number of panels can perform really in a different way. Layout, inverter technique, vent positioning, obstacles, wire runs, and roofing plane option all impact real-world outcomes. Good layout is both technical and useful. It should make the most of manufacturing without developing maintenance migraines or making your home resemble an afterthought.
One usual point of complication is panel performance. Higher-efficiency panels can be useful, particularly when roofing system area is limited, however they are not instantly the very best worth. If your roofing has adequate room, a somewhat lower-efficiency panel from a proven manufacturer may generate the exact same total energy at a much better installed expense. The right installer explains that compromise instead of pushing one of the most pricey module as if it were self-evidently superior.
Inverter option also forms the system's actions. String inverters can work well in simpler roof layouts with very little shading. Microinverters or optimizers typically make more feeling on roofing systems with multiple orientations or periodic shade. Neither alternative is generally "best." The better fit depends on the residential or commercial property and on just how much presence and panel-level manage the homeowner wants.
A polished proposition must reveal yearly manufacturing, system dimension in kilowatts, estimated first-year outcome in kilowatt-hours, and major equipment choices. It should also discuss why the range is being positioned where it is. If the design appears driven by installer benefit instead of site conditions, that deserves pressing on.

Every home owner desires value. That is practical. Solar is a major purchase, and comparing propositions without discussing price would certainly be impractical. However the most affordable proposal commonly leaves out something that matters, whether that is a panel upgrade, keeping an eye on bundle, electrical job, critter guard, allow coordination, or stronger service coverage.
A really reduced quote can additionally mirror aggressive presumptions regarding labor. If the installer counts on tight margins and rushed staffs, quality may experience where you can not conveniently see it, under the modules, at roof covering infiltrations, in flashed add-ons, or inside the electric job. Those details seldom make the sales pamphlet, yet they matter long after the financing paperwork is signed.
A better way to compare bids is to take a look at rate alongside range and anticipated manufacturing. If one quote is considerably less expensive, ask why. Often the answer is reputable, such as simpler equipment or a business with reduced overhead. Sometimes the response is much less comforting, like weak craftsmanship criteria or bad after-sale support.
There is likewise a funding trap worth stating. Property owners usually compare regular monthly payments rather than total system cost. A lower regular monthly repayment can merely mean a longer term, a higher dealer fee baked into funding, or a framework that covers the real mounted rate. Request the cash money cost even if you plan to fund. It keeps the numbers grounded.

Solar propositions generally feature a number of layers of guarantee language, and it is simple to obtain shed in them. Panel producers may use long product and performance guarantees. Inverter manufacturers do the very same. Installers may provide handiwork service warranties covering roofing infiltrations, placing equipment, or installation issues. Those are all appropriate, however paperwork alone is not protection.
The actual concern is that will coordinate the solution if something goes wrong. A supplier guarantee is just as beneficial as the procedure for diagnosis, labor authorization, substitute, and reinstallation. Property owners commonly assume "25-year service warranty" means someone will appear quickly and take care of every little thing. In method, response time and service high quality licensed solar installation Fairfield depend heavily on the installer.
Ask bluntly how solution jobs. If an inverter fails in year seven, whom do you call? If the surveillance reveals one panel underperforming, who checks out? If a roofing leak shows up near an add-on factor, just how is responsibility figured out? The business worth working with have operational responses, not obscure reassurance.

Solar choices increasingly converge with battery storage space and electrification plans. Also if you are not mounting a battery now, it deserves discussing whether you might want one later. The exact same chooses future electrical power need. A family planning to purchase an electric automobile, add a heat pump, or transform gas appliances to electric may outgrow a system developed just around current usage.
A thoughtful installer will inquire about those future tons. They might recommend sizing the system with some headroom if roofing system space permits, or a minimum of choosing equipment that makes future development useful. Not every home can warrant that technique, and utility rules occasionally restrict oversizing, yet the conversation ought to occur. A system that completely fits in 2014's utility bill might really feel undersized 2 years from now.
Battery conversations need to additionally be realistic. Storage can give backup power and some rate-management advantages, however the economics differ extensively depending on neighborhood energy structures, blackout frequency, and your goals. Be careful of any person providing batteries as universally crucial or universally crazy. The appropriate answer depends upon the home.

Solar panels require a significant upfront investment and may not be suitable for every roof. Electricity production decreases during cloudy weather and stops at night unless battery storage is available. Roof repairs may require temporary panel removal. Inverters and other system components may need replacement during the system's lifespan.
